The Crisis
Chronic diseases are the leading cause of death and disability in Washington. With nearly 3 million Washington residents suffering from one of the seven most common chronic diseases, the state has reached a chronic disease crisis.
And it doesn't just stop there. In addition to the profound effects of chronic disease on the people of Washington, the state is experiencing profound financial effects. Chronic diseases cost the state billions of dollars -- total costs related to chronic disease, including direct expenditures (e.g., health care costs) and indirect costs (e.g., lost productivity) amount to $23.1 billion.
